Museum
Mevlevi Tekke Museum is a tekke in , , currently in . It has historically been used by the Mevlevi Order and now serves as a museum. is situated 1 km south of Vasfi’s.

Neighborhood
Yenişehir; Greek: Νεάπολη Neapoli; literally meaning "new city" both in Turkish and Greek) is a suburb of . Its population was 4156 in 2006, with 2135 males and 2021 females.
